Bamboo has a higher compressive strength than wood, brick or concrete and a tensile strength that rivals steel. A protective coating made up of borax and boric is used to resist Bamboo's material propensity to insects and rot, leading the way for projects such as the Green School in Bali, Indonesia, constructed entirely of bamboo, for its beauty and advantages as a sustainable resource. FACTS Reported growth of Bamboo over a 24 hr period: 2.5m Height of largest timber Bamboo: 30m Diameter of largest timber Bamboo: 15-20cm
